- MMatthewVIPLos Angeles •37 reviews5.0Dined on Feb 10, 2025Bell's is, without a doubt, one of my favorite restaurants in the entire state of California. Along with its sister restaurant, Bar Le Cote in Los Olivos, it offers cuisine influenced by both the local products of the Central Coast (locally-farmed produce, Santa Barbara sea urchin, and the like), and both modern and classic European influences. I make it a point to visit at least one, if not both, of these two restaurants, whenever I am in the area, and I would consider them to be worth a trip or at at least a detour, when driving up and down the California coast. The food is fresh, innovative, and extremely flavorful, and the service is always top notch. The a la carte lunch menu at Bell's is extremely fun.
